Answer by MathTherapy(10858)   (Show Source): You can put this solution on YOUR website!
The Sum of Two Digits Number is same as its product. find the Number?
Ans is 22 but I dont know how it comes.
Let number’s tens and units digits be T and U, respectively
Then: T + U = TU
TU – T = U
T(U – 1) = U

In order for T to be an integer > 0 in the above equation, U – 1 MUST BE 1.
We then get: U - 1 = 1
U = 1 + 1, or
